As a piagetian, avery would consider _____ the highest accomplishment of the sensorimotor period of development.
Oduvanchick [21]
<span>As a Piagetian, Avery would consider using symbols the highest accomplishment of the sensorimotor period of development.

Piaget developed the theory of various stages of cognitive development. The first stage of cognitive development is the sensorimotor stage (0-2 years of age). The sensorimotor stage of development in turn consists of six sub stages. The most advanced and highest </span>accomplishment of the sensorimotor period of development is when children are able to use symbolic thought to form mental representations of objects. In other words, children at this advanced sub stage are able to mentally visualize objects that are not physically in their field of vision.
